About the role

We have an exciting opportunity for a Security Risk Analyst to join our team to support SLC change initiatives by assisting in the application and assurance of security requirements for projects and supporting them through their delivery lifecycle. As part of their role, the successful candidate will assess informational and technical risks in terms of impact to systems, service confidentiality, integrity and availability, and report and elevate results of risk assessments, whilst providing guidance as to security requirements and control suitability for technical proposals and technical specification documents, in relation to the organisations information security framework and assurance requirements.

The Risk Analyst will also create security reports, risk review reports, and other security documentation to support Business As Usual (BAU), and Continuous Improvement (CI) efforts, with occasional support to larger project activities, whilst promoting compliance with Government security guidance to internal stakeholders.

What you bring

  • Knowledge of security frameworks and standards such as ISO 27001, NIST, OWASP, MITRE.
  • Experience of performing risk assessments, providing recommendations for meeting the security requirements of systems and information systems so that they remain compliant with internal standards and published regulations and legislation.
  • A pragmatic approach to Risk assessment and the application of mitigation activities for information security.
